Google Chrome Plans Pricing
The Chrome browser and its developer-facing APIs (Extensions, DevTools Protocol, Web Platform primitives) are free. Commercial pricing applies only to Chrome Enterprise Premium for managed-fleet customers and the one-time Chrome Web Store developer registration fee.
Plans
Free access to Chrome's developer APIs - Extensions, DevTools Protocol, Web Platform primitives, and the Chrome User Experience (CrUX) API. Used to build extensions, automate the browser, and instrument web performance.

Free management tier for IT teams to deploy and manage Chrome browser at scale via the Google Admin console (policies, version pinning, extension allowlists).

Paid tier adding advanced security (data loss prevention, context-aware access, threat and data protection insights) and Gemini-in-Chrome AI features for managed users.
